临界状态下的三项Diophantine方程
引用本文:汤干文.临界状态下的三项Diophantine方程[J].数学杂志,2012,32(5):889-896.
作者姓名:汤干文
作者单位:贺州学院数学系,广西贺州,542800
摘    要:本文研究临界状态下三项Diophantine方程解的问题.运用无穷递降法证明了:设m,n,r是大于1的正整数,当1/m+1/n+1/r=1时,方程xm+yn=zn,min(x,y,z)>1,gcd(x,y)=1无正整数解(x,y,z).

关 键 词:三项Diophantine方程  临界状态下  无穷递降法

THE TERNARY DIOPHANTINE EQUATION UNDER CRITICAL STATE
TANG Gan-wen.THE TERNARY DIOPHANTINE EQUATION UNDER CRITICAL STATE[J].Journal of Mathematics,2012,32(5):889-896.
Authors:TANG Gan-wen
Institution:TANG Gan-wen(Department of Mathematics,Hezhou College,Hezhou 542800,China)
Abstract:In this paper,we study ternary Diophantine equation under critical state.By using the infinite descent method,we prove,let m,n,r be fixed positive integers large than one,that if 1/m + 1/n + 1/r = 1,then the equation xm+ yn = zn,min(x,y,z) > 1,gcd(x,y) = 1,has no positive integer solution(x,y,z).
Keywords:ternary diophantine equation  critical state  infinite descent method
